Canadian Coast Guard vessel Terry Fox , and Canadian vessel Skandi Vinland, return to St. John's Port in Newfoundland, Canada, after supporting the search and rescue operation for the Titan submersible.Efforts to recover the remains of the Titan submersible that suffered a catastrophic implosion near the Titanic wreckage are currently underway, and as of Sunday, had descended to the seafloor for a fourth dive.
South Wellfleet, Massachusetts-based Pelagic Research Services was contacted by OceanGate, the company behind Titan, for use of its remotely operated vehicles, or “ROVs,” to assist with the search.
